(+1) 860-575-3694
info@swescoalumniusa.org

News

file_8740(1)

Основания функционирования Linux для новичков

Linux выступает собой операционной систему с свободным оригинальным программным текстом. Платформа была создана в 1991 году благодаря финскому программисту Линусу Торвальдсу. Сейчас применяется на серверах, личных компьютерах, портативных устройствах и вмонтированных системах.

Доступный код позволяет всякому пользователю познавать, корректировать и распространять платформу. Программисты со всего мира делают участие в развитие ядра и софтверных обеспечения. Подобный подход обеспечивает высокую стабильность и защищённость.

Система свободна для использования. Юзеры не отдают за разрешения и могут устанавливать 7к на неограниченное объём машин. Сохранение ресурсов превращает продукт интересным для обучающих институтов и небольшого бизнеса.

Гибкость регулировки отличает платформу среди соперников. Пользователи подбирают графическую окружение, коллекцию софта и настройки функционирования по своему желанию. Варианты настройки почти неисчерпаемы.

Что это за ОС и чем она различается от Windows

Организация платформы создаётся на принципах Unix. Центральный компонент контролирует техническими ресурсами, а пользовательские утилиты действуют в выделенном пространстве. Компонентная конструкция даёт стабильность и защиту от отказов.

Принцип дистрибуции радикально разнится от проприетарных решений. Оригинальный программный текст открыт каждому желающим для познания и изменения. Windows эксплуатирует частную принцип создания.

Каталоговая система построена по-другому. Вместо разделов C:, D:, E: применяется объединённое дерево каталогов с основанием в /. Системные файлы хранятся в /etc, приложения в /usr/bin, домашние директории в /home.

Администрирование приложениями выполняется через пакетные системы управления. Размещение и актуализация программ выполняется централизовано из источников. В казино7к пользователи загружают установщики с разнообразных ресурсов.

Полномочия к данным организованы ограниченнее. Стандартный юзер не может модифицировать критические данные без прямого повышения прав.

Варианты Linux

Дистрибутив выступает собой подготовленную конфигурацию операционной системы. Любая конфигурация объединяет центральный компонент, коллекцию программ, графическую окружение и инструменты регулировки.

Ubuntu признаётся популярным выбором для новичков. Версия даёт понятную инсталляцию, дружелюбный среду и развёрнутую документацию. Версии с длительной поддержкой получают актуализации в течение пяти лет.

Fedora ориентирована на новейшие разработки и новое программное оснащение. Специалисты оперативно внедряют актуальные опции. Версия годится активным пользователям, стремящимся трудиться с прогрессивными утилитами.

Debian известен стабильностью и надёжностью. Пакеты проходят детальное тестирование перед включением в источник. Серверные администраторы нередко выбирают 7к казино для критически важных конфигураций.

Arch создан для квалифицированных юзеров. Размещение подразумевает персональной регулировки через текстовую консоль. Концепция сборки включает абсолютный контроль над ОС.

Mint построен на базе Ubuntu с упором на простоту и готовыми библиотеками для медиаконтента.

Каталоговая система Linux

Иерархия папок отсчитывается с базовой папки /. Любые документы, директории и устройства помещаются в пределах этого целостного дерева. Отсутствие символов томов упрощает перемещение.

Папка /bin вмещает базовые исполняемые программы. Утилиты ls, cp, mv и прочие ключевые инструменты находятся здесь и доступны каждому владельцам.

Папка /etc хранит конфигурационные данные. Конфигурации сети, характеристики сервисов и системные конфигурации находятся в этой директории. Операторы корректируют документы для корректировки функционирования 7к.

Директория /home содержит пользовательские директории владельцев. Всякий профиль получает выделенную каталог для документов и настроек программ.

Директория /var служит для изменяемых файлов. Записи ОС, кэш приложений и краткосрочные файлы сохраняются тут.

Каталог /tmp отведена для временного содержания. Данные самостоятельно стираются при перезагрузке.

Монтирование устройств выполняется в /mnt или /media. Внешние носители добавляются как вложенные папки.

Консоль и командная строка: зачем они нужны и как с ними подружиться

Командная оболочка открывает непосредственный доступ к системе через текстовые директивы. Интерфейс даёт возможность совершать операции оперативнее оконных приложений. Немалые административные задачи предполагают действий в консольной оболочке.

Инструкция ls отображает состав папки. Параметр -l демонстрирует подробную сведения о файлах. Навигация по директориям осуществляется через cd с указанием пути.

Создание данных выполняется утилитой touch. Удаление осуществляется через rm, дублирование через cp. Перемещение и переименование выполняет команда mv.

Права доступа модифицируются командой chmod. Команда воспринимает цифровые или текстовые записи. Хозяина данных меняет chown с заданием юзера.

Чтение текстовых файлов возможен через cat или less. Первая отображает весь документ, следующая обеспечивает возможность пролистывать постранично. Правка выполняется в nano или vim.

Нахождение файлов осуществляет инструкция find с указаниями расположения. Нахождение содержимого внутри данных выполняет grep. Подстановка по Tab ускоряет написание в 7к казино.

Владельцы и коллективы: концепция защиты и администрирование к данным

Система дифференцирует разрешения владельцев для охраны данных. Каждый учётная запись приобретает неповторимый идентификатор UID. Обычные пользователи не имеют возможность изменять критические данные.

Администратор root располагает абсолютными привилегиями. Аккаунт позволяет выполнять какие угодно задачи без запретов. Регулярная использование от аккаунта root не рекомендуется.

Команда sudo временно расширяет привилегии. Пользователь осуществляет управленческие операции, указывая личный ключ доступа. После завершения привилегии возвращаются к стандартному уровню.

Коллективы собирают пользователей для группового использования. Документы принадлежат собственнику и коллективу. Регулировка разрешений контролирует чтение, запись и запуск.

Контроль владельцами содержит действия:

  • Генерация аккаунта утилитой useradd
  • Стирание через userdel
  • Смена ключа доступа инструментом passwd
  • Внесение в коллектив утилитой usermod с опцией -aG
  • Просмотр коллективов инструкцией groups

Данные /etc/passwd включает информацию об аккаунтах в казино7к.

Модули управления и аппаратура: как Linux взаимодействует с компонентами

Центральный компонент системы содержит интегрированные драйверы для большинства устройств. Самостоятельное определение оборудования осуществляется при запуске. Графические адаптеры, коммуникационные контроллеры и аудио карты в большинстве случаев работают немедленно.

Компоненты ядра системы представляют собой подключаемые программные модули. Инструкция lsmod показывает реестр активных компонентов. Внедрение дополнительного модуля реализуется через modprobe, извлечение через rmmod.

Проприетарные драйверы предполагают отдельной установки. Компании NVIDIA и AMD обеспечивают проприетарные драйверы для наивысшей быстродействия. Установка происходит через модульные управляющие программы или сценарии.

Инструкция lspci показывает активные PCI-устройства. Инструмент lsusb выводит информацию об USB-оборудовании. Подробные информация находятся в каталогах /proc и /sys.

Директория /dev вмещает служебные файлы устройств. Физические накопители отображены как /dev/sda, разделы нумеруются /dev/sda1, /dev/sda2. Работа происходит через чтение и модификацию в данные файлы.

Команда dmesg выводит уведомления центрального компонента о активном компонентах и помогает выявлять сбои в 7к.

Размещение софта

Модульные системы управления автоматизируют размещение софтверного ПО. Система скачивает модули из источников, анализирует зависимости и конфигурирует утилиты. Объединённый подход оптимизирует контроль софтом.

Менеджер APT задействуется в дистрибутивах на платформе Debian. Инструкция apt install инсталлирует приложение с самостоятельной получением зависимостей. Синхронизация реестра осуществляется через apt update, актуализация приложений через apt upgrade.

Менеджер DNF применяется в Fedora и похожих версиях. Инсталляция утилиты осуществляется утилитой dnf install, стирание через dnf remove.

Система управления Pacman действует в Arch и производных системах. Утилита pacman -S ставит пакет, pacman -R уничтожает.

Snap-модули содержат приложение со всеми требованиями. Защищённая пространство гарантирует защищённость. Инсталляция осуществляется утилитой snap install.

Flatpak даёт другой тип кроссплатформенных пакетов. Приложения работают в контейнере с урезанным взаимодействием. Инструкция flatpak install загружает программы из Flathub в 7к казино.

Задачи и сервисы: как проверять, прерывать и рестартовать процессы

Программы выступают собой активные программы в системе. Всякий программа имеет индивидуальный код PID. Операционная платформа назначает средства между выполняющимися задачами.

Инструкция ps демонстрирует список активных задач. Параметр aux выводит любые задачи с подробной сведениями. Программа top демонстрирует задачи в реальном режиме.

Закрытие процесса реализуется утилитой kill с вводом PID. Сигнал SIGTERM просит программу правильно прекратиться. Сообщение SIGKILL насильственно завершает процесс.

Сервисы работают в скрытом состоянии и стартуют без участия пользователя. Инструмент systemd контролирует демонами через команду systemctl.

Главные действия со демонами:

  • Активация инструкцией systemctl start
  • Прекращение через systemctl stop
  • Перезагрузка утилитой systemctl restart
  • Просмотр состояния через systemctl status
  • Включение автозапуска инструкцией systemctl enable
  • Выключение через systemctl disable

Инструкция journalctl показывает логи демонов в казино7к.

Практические советы начинающему

Стартуйте изучение с удобного версии. Ubuntu или Linux Mint обеспечивают понятную размещение и понятный оформление. Оконные средства дают возможность совершать действия без текстовой строки.

Создайте резервную бэкап критичных файлов перед опытами. Освоение ОС может привести к сбоям настройки. Постоянное страховочное сохранение защитит сведения.

Осваивайте консоль постепенно. Стартуйте с фундаментальных утилит перемещения и взаимодействия с данными. Практика фиксирует навыки результативнее чтения документации.

Применяйте авторскую документацию версии. Справочные страницы предлагают решения частых неполадок. Форумы сообщества содействуют найти разъяснения на вопросы.

Модернизируйте платформу систематически. Обновлённые пакеты имеют исправления защиты и свежие возможности.

Не оперируйте всё время от учётной записи главного пользователя. Задействуйте sudo только для системных действий. Ограничение привилегий сокращает опасность повреждения системы.

Пробуйте с разнообразными программами. Источники включают тысячи свободных утилит. Опробование ПО способствует обнаружить оптимальные утилиты.